
Derbylite
Derbylite is a rare mineral with the chemical formula Fe^3⁺4Ti^4⁺3Sb^3⁺O13(OH). It belongs to the monoclinic crystal system and is classified under the Strunz system as 4.JB.55. This mineral is characterized by its metallic luster, dark coloration, and relatively high density. Its physical properties include moderate hardness and a composition that reflects its complex mix of iron, titanium, and antimony. Derbylite is considered a member of the oxide mineral group, and its unique chemical structure contributes to its rarity and specialized classification within mineralogy.

Etymology
Derbylite is named after Orville Adalbert Derby, a notable figure in the field of mineralogy. The mineral was recognized and named in his honor, though no specific discovery year is provided in the available facts.
